| Mesh Size | Rope Thickness | Application Scenarios |
|---|---|---|
| 3cm | 4mm | Prevent children from throwing objects, cat escape prevention, small ball games (e.g., stadiums, table tennis courts) |
| 5cm | 5mm | Stair safety, balcony protection, patio protection, construction, decoration, breeding |
| 10cm | 6mm | Construction sites, football fields, basketball courts, field fences, clothes hanging nets, car sealing nets, green isolation nets |
